Legends: The McLaren F1

The McLaren F1, a car so fast that it had a speed record over 20 miles per hour faster than the previous one. The F1 is probably the most revolutionary car of all time. There was just something about this car that no other car could compare to. This is the story of the legendary Mclaren F1.

I would say the most advanced thing about the F1 has to be its engine. Originally it was designed to go in the new 1991 BMW 850i, but that project was an overall failure. With so many problems very few were made. There were so many many hadn’t even been built yet because they scraped the project. So BMW had all these extra V12 engines but nowhere to put them at the time. But when Gordon Murray of McLaren was designing their first road car ever he had one problem, what engine to use. So he picked up every single one of the leftover BMW engines and even asked them to make more. He and the McLaren team fixed every one of the problems with those engines. This gave the legendary engine over 620 horsepower and 520-pound feet of torque. To this day, the insane sounding engine in the F1 is still one of the most powerful naturally aspirated engines ever.

 When the Mclaren F1 came out it had one of the best looking engine bays ever with NASA inspired gold tape that reflected heat. There was just something about this engine bay that no other car could compare to. 

The unique engine bay was also fitted into another very revolutionary part of the car. The 620 horsepower naturally aspirated V12 was fitted to the first-ever Carbon Fibre Monocoque chassis. It was made with the exact same process as F1 cars by putting carbon fibre in heat chambers to stiffen up and then all of the pieces would be glued together to make an incredible chassis which only weighed 220 pounds! A two-person team could easily lift it, that’s crazy! 

The other insane thing about this car was it was actually the fastest car in the world for over 14 years. As Jerimiah from Donut Media said “you could have gone to preschool in 1992 and when you graduate High School the Mclaren F1 would still be the fastest car in the world” the record was also 24 miles per hour more than the previous record set by the Jaguar XJ220, another very legendary Gordan Murray designed car.

 When the Guinness World Records officially named it the fastest road-legal car in the world for going 240 miles per hour (Average over 2 runs). The Mclaren Team was so happy that their first road legal car ever was the fastest car in the world. This was a huge achievement for Mclaren. 

But, I would say the coolest thing about the F1 was the center seat positing. This meant that the driver would be in the center of the car giving it perfect weight balance. It would also give really good visibility of the road compared to the other hypercars at the time. Every single control feature was placed in a convenient spot and the pedals were right in front of the driver for a perfect driving position.
